Karissa Williams is used to getting what she wants. She's worked hard to make it that way after being deprived of several chances to shine in middle school by resident mean girl Sadie Harmon. With it being senior year now, she plans to give one last stand-out performance but her plans are quickly dismantled by her own arrogance. Or maybe, the invincible girl with big hair and an even bigger voice is a little insecure. One thing about the spotlight is that it makes you immune to everything that happens behind the scenes and when Sadie steps in to replace the budding performer all of the emotions (some good but on to that later) she'd previously tried to bury suddenly resurface. Jayson Reyes lives in the shadow of his older brother. He's laidback and funny with just the smallest fear of commitment. Whilst these traits have made him popular at school they're also the reason why his family tends to second-guess him a lot. Both Karissa and Jayson have spent considerable amounts of time both in and out of the spotlight so it makes complete sense that they're so close but what with all of Karissa's old feelings resurfacing, who knows how much longer they'll stay friends for. Maybe they'll become something more.
